Sweet, savory, and irresistibly tender, Crock Pot Apricot Chicken is the ultimate weeknight dinner solution that feels anything but ordinary. This easy-to-make dish combines juicy boneless chicken breasts with a luscious sauce made from tangy apricot preserves, zesty Dijon mustard, and umami-packed soy sauce, all enhanced by the subtle warmth of garlic and thyme. Slow-cooked to perfection, the chicken becomes meltingly tender while the sauce thickens into a flavorful glaze that's perfect for drizzling over rice or veggies. Place chicken breasts in the bottom of the crock pot.
In a medium bowl, whisk together apricot preserves, soy sauce, Dijon mustard, minced garlic, dried thyme, salt, black pepper, and chicken broth.
Pour the sauce mixture evenly over the chicken breasts.
Cover the crock pot with the lid and cook on LOW for 4-5 hours or on HIGH for 2-3 hours, until the chicken is tender and fully cooked (internal temperature reaches 165°F).
Once the chicken is cooked, remove it from the crock pot and set aside on a plate, keeping it warm.
In a small bowl, mix the cornstarch and water to form a slurry. Stir the slurry into the sauce in the crock pot to thicken it.
Turn the crock pot to HIGH and let the sauce cook for an additional 5-10 minutes until it reaches your desired thickness.
Return the chicken to the crock pot and coat it with the thickened sauce.
Serve the chicken warm, garnished with chopped parsley if desired. This dish pairs well with rice or roasted vegetables.
